Output 231e34d69e532ef5b495f9178c0709f7a4855c6e8110f28c886b3ba6c734e953:3

value
17185897824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eac2f84a05f2f30b26cfb6c92c80f8550b0a6cf OP_EQUAL
address
MGXk28R9utf1bnUqFuCeWhhC8cHjHZuMt4
transaction
231e34d69e532ef5b495f9178c0709f7a4855c6e8110f28c886b3ba6c734e953
spent
true